About The Position

The Senior Quality Engineer at State Street Bank and Trust Company in Boston, Massachusetts, will be responsible for the design, development, and maintenance of new and existing automation frameworks. This role involves the continuous evaluation of test cases for inclusion in test regression, test coverage, and the automation of newly implemented functionality, as well as the development of tools to enhance QA efficiencies. The engineer will collaborate closely with Software Developers and Product Owners in an iterative manner to establish and adhere to quality procedures, standards, and specifications, ensuring that high-quality products are delivered in a timely and cost-effective way. Requirements

  • Master’s degree or equivalent in Computer Science, or related technical field plus 3 years as a quality engineer or a test automation specialist or any occupation/title providing relevant work experience
  • Alternatively, a bachelor’s degree or equivalent in Computer Science, or related technical field plus 5 years as a quality engineer or a test automation specialist or any occupation/title providing relevant work experience
  • Hands-on experience with writing automation test code and utilizing leading industry standard tools (Ranorex, Postman, SoapUI, IDEs, Terminal, IBM RIT, etc.,) and frameworks that can simulate complex multi-system scenarios
  • Proficiency with automated testing types (Unit, Functional, Load, Security, Behavioral, Integration, Component, Contract, End-to-End)
  • Understanding of web technologies, including web services, web application services and RESTful APIs
  • Experience with SQL, Stored Procedures, and usage of IBM DB2 related tools and utilities
  • Experience with Scrum, Agile modelling, and adaptive software development
  • Experience with IBM Rational Developer for zOS, build process, and deployment
  • Experience with Production Support activities and root cause analysis
  • Proven ability to apply knowledge and skills to a range of standard and moderately complex activities
  • Proven verbal and written communication skills
  • Demonstrated experience writing and reviewing technology documents including user guides
